CBP-1029 is a bispecific antibody-drug conjugate (ADC) being developed by Coherent Biopharma for the treatment of solid cancers. It utilizes the company's proprietary Bi-XDC (bi-targeting ligand-drug conjugate) technology platform to deliver a topoisomerase inhibitor payload directly to tumor cells. The Bi-XDC platform is designed to enhance tumor specificity and therapeutic index by targeting two distinct antigens simultaneously. While the specific molecular targets for CBP-1029 have not been publicly disclosed, the drug is part of a pipeline of next-generation conjugates aimed at overcoming resistance and reducing systemic toxicity in oncology. It is currently in the early stages of development.
